Synopsis: At first glance, twenty-two-year-old Brianna’s life seems perfect. But she harbors a deadly secret—her father is the leader of a ruthless drug cartel. Brianna struggles to find her place in a world her father meticulously controls, and believes she is nothing but a pawn in her father’s deadly games.
After graduating from college with an enormous debt, Dominic finds himself lured by money and power into a job that appears too good to be true. He doesn’t realize he works for a drug cartel until he’s in too deep. Trying to keep his family safe, he takes a deal offered by Brianna’s father and agrees to marry Brianna while continuing to work for the cartel.
Brianna and Dominic must rely on one another as their lives become further entwined in the lethal drug world. When Dominic discovers a deadly secret, he begins to question everything and turns to Brianna for support. However, Brianna’s heart belongs to another man—an undercover DEA agent.
The DEA closes in on the drug cartel, forcing Brianna and Dominic to choose sides, igniting a battle between family loyalty, love, and survival. Brianna soon realizes that she may be the only person capable of bringing down her father’s empire—if she can find a way to outsmart the master manipulator, without losing herself, and her heart, in the process.
Interview with Jennifer:
Tell us about the story.
It’s basically about a girl in her early twenties who is being controlled by her crazy drug cartel father. She falls hard for an undercover DEA agent all the while her father plans for her to marry a fellow drug lord.
Where did you get the inspiration for it?
It was a dream that I had and couldn’t shake. I kept playing around with it in my head until I realized I needed to write it down.
How long did it take you to write it?
This is actually the first story I wrote, even though it’s my fifth book published. I know it took me forever to write because I didn’t know what I was doing at the time. So maybe around 1-2 years? I honestly don’t remember.
Where is your story set? A fictional place or somewhere you’ve visited/ lived?
The story is set right here in San Diego where I live. Almost every single place in the book is a real place I’ve been to. When I wrote the Crystal Pier scene, I actually drove to the pier, parked, and walked to the end of it so I could experience the same sensations my characters would.

About the author:
Jennifer graduated from the University of San Diego with a degree in English and a teaching credential. Afterwards, she finally married her best friend and high school sweetheart. Jennifer is currently a full-time writer and mother of three young children. Her days are spent living in imaginary worlds and fueling her own kids’ creativity.
